Trim &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age vs. DIY: When to Call a Pro

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a single baseboard Yes No DIY fixes are often quick and easy, but be sure to inspect the affected area thoroughly to prevent further damage.
Large-scale water damage in multiple areas No Yes Professional teams have the equipment and expertise to handle large-scale water damage quickly and efficiently.
Structural damage to baseboards or trim No Yes Structural damage needs professional attention to ensure the integrity of your home.
Water damage in a high-moisture area (kitchen, bathroom) No Yes High-moisture areas need special attention to prevent mold growth and water damage.
Visible signs of mold or mildew No Yes Visible signs of mold or mildew need professional attention to prevent further damage and potential health risks.
Water damage in a hard-to-reach area No Yes Hard-to-reach areas need professional equ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ively.

Not all water damage situations need professional attention, but it’s always better to err on the side of caution. If you’re unsure about the extent of the damage or how to proceed, call a pro. Trim &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age Cost in Redmond, WA

The cost of trim and baseboard replacement after water damage can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Redmond, WA. Estimates are just that actual costs may be higher or lower based on your specific situation. Our team will provide a detailed, no-obligation quote after assessing your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Trim Replacement (single area) $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area, material used, and labor costs.
Baseboard Replacement (multiple areas) $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, material used, and labor costs.
Water Damage Cleanup (small-scale) $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area, material used, and labor costs.
Water Damage Cleanup (large-scale) $2,000 – $10,000 Size of the affected area, material used, and labor costs.
Structural Repair (baseboards or trim) $2,000 – $10,000 Size of the affected area, material used, and labor costs.
Mold Remediation (small-scale) $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area, material used, and labor costs.
